EMP T1 - Population aged 15 to 64 by economic activity status

EMP T1 - Population aged 15 to 64 by economic activity status
2008 2013 2019
Altogether 12 416 12 214 10 881
Labor force in % 64,5 67,3 70,6
 including people in work in % 40,0 43,3 42,5
 including unemployed workers in % 24,4 24,0 28,1
Economically inactive people in % 35,5 32,7 29,4
 including pupils, students or interns in % 13,2 10,6 10,3
 including retirees in % 7,0 6,5 4,3
 including other economically inactive people in % 15,4 15,6 14,8
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, main operations, geography as of 01/01/2022.

EMP T4 - Unemployment of the 15-64 aged population

EMP T4 - Unemployment of the 15-64 aged population
2008 2013 2019
Number of unemployed workers 3 032 2 937 3 056
Unemployment rate in % 37,9 35,7 39,8
Unemployment of the 15-24 aged 64,9 64,3 65,8
Unemployment of the 25-54 aged 36,2 34,8 39,7
Unemployment of the 55-64 aged 23,4 20,8 28,6
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, main operations, geography as of 01/01/2022.

EMP T5 - Employment and activity

EMP T5 - Employment and activity
2008 2013 2019
Number of jobs in the area 3 203 3 383 3 277
People in work living in the area 5 032 5 389 4 797
Employment concentration indicator 63,7 62,8 68,3
Activity rate of 15 years old and over in % 53,4 53,9 53,3
  • The employment concentration indicator is equal to the number of jobs in the area per 100 people in work living in the area.
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, main holdings, place of residence and place of work, geography as of 01/01/2022.
